Once completed in 2014, the new Ford Alabang will become one of Ford's largest dealerships in the ASEAN region. It sits on a 4,000 sq meter land area along Alabang-Zapote Road and boast of a four-floor layout that houses a 25-vehicle showroom and 80-vehicle servicing capacity.
Meanwhile, Ford Pampanga is currently the Philippines' second dealership built according to Ford' Brand@Retail II design standard that follows the brand's pillars of Quality, Green, Safe, and Smart. This layout should help the customer feel more comfortable and thus get a better Ford experience. The newly-opened showroom can fit 13 cars on display while its two-storey service facility can accommodate up to 27 vehicles.
Ford ASEAN President Matt Bradley flew in the country just to celebrate the milestone with Ford Philippines President Randy Krieger along with Ford Alabang and Ford Pampanga's dealer principals.
“The continued expansion of our Ford dealer network will help further drive our momentum in the Philippines, as well as help to support our overall, aggressive growth plans for the ASEAN region,” said Matt Bradley, Ford ASEAN President. “In addition to the introduction of segment-leading One Ford vehicles, we are absolutely committed to further improving our customer experience, which includes customer convenience from an even wider network of nationwide coverage.”
The next Ford globally-designed dealerships will open in Butuan, Naga, Bohol, Tarlac, Isabela, Makati, General Santos, Laoag, Zamboanga, Manila Bay, and Baguio. When all has been completed, it'll bring the total number of Ford dealerships to 35 in the Philippines.
